MATTER OF UNIVERSAL TILE CORP. v. CHICAGO MASTIC CO.


12 A.D.2d 450 (1960)

In the Matter of Universal Tile Corp., Respondent, v. Chicago Mastic Company, Appellant

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, First Department.

November 1, 1960


Order, entered on March 25, 1960, which granted reargument, recalled original decision and granted defendant's motion to remove to the Supreme Court the action pending in the Municipal Court of the City of New York, First District, Borough of The Bronx, unanimously reversed, on the law, with $20 costs and disbursements to appellant, and the motion to remove denied, with $10 costs, on authority of Matter of Annis Int. v.
